We flew into Houston and stayed in College Station. Aggie fans were really cool and welcoming.

Two bar recommendations:
--The Dixie Chicken. This is a fairly iconic and large bar.
--The Shot Bar. I've never seen anything like this place. You enter from one street, go through and order shots, take the shots, then exit out onto the other street. You're supposed to keep moving. No beer--just shots. And there is barely any room for customers--just a narrow passage running along the bar.
